Как устроены системы обработки инцидентов в реальном времени

Как устроены системы обработки инцидентов в реальном времени

Механизмы обработки происшествий в реальном времени составляют собой набор софтверных компонентов, которые принимают, исследуют и обрабатывают последовательности данных с наименьшей латентностью. Такие механизмы функционируют непрерывно, предоставляя немедленную реакцию на поступающую сведения.

Фундамент архитектуры составляют три главных элемента: источники инцидентов, обработчики и хранилища данных. Источники формируют постоянный поток данных через выделенные соединения. Обработчики производят отбор, модификацию и суммирование данных согласно установленным правилам.

Современные решения применяют распределенную построение для обеспечения значительной эффективности. Приходящие события распределяются между совокупностью компонентов обработки, что предоставляет 1хбет расширяться горизонтально и преобразовывать миллионы происшествий в секунду.

Критическим показателем является время ответа — интервал между приемом происшествия и предоставлением итога. Надежные решения обрабатывают данные за миллисекунды, что существенно для финансовых переводов и комплексов охраны.

Источники инцидентов: сенсоры, приложения, логи, переводы и пользовательские действия

События попадают в систему из различных источников, каждый из которых производит специфический формат данных. Датчики производственного аппаратуры отправляют данные температуры, давления, вибрации и прочих физических показателей с скоростью до сотен измерений в секунду.

Веб-приложения и мобильные службы формируют происшествия при взаимодействии пользователя с оболочкой. Клики, обзоры страниц, включение товаров генерируют непрестанный последовательность действий. Серверные сервисы регистрируют запросы к API и модификации состояния подключений.

Системные логи отслеживают технические события: ошибки, предостережения, информационные сообщения о работе инфраструктуры. Особые службы получают данные с серверов и контейнеров, направляя их в 1xbet казино для централизованной обработки.

Экономические операции генерируют критически ключевые происшествия при операциях и оплатах. Банковские системы формируют данные о каждой операции с картой и изменении баланса. Трейдинговые решения записывают заявки на покупку и реализацию активов.

Построение непрерывной обработки

Непрерывная преобразование базируется на основе беспрерывного потока данных через последовательность модулей без переходного сохранения. Происшествия движутся через последовательность модификаций, где каждый элемент осуществляет определённую роль: селекцию, расширение, объединение или направление.

Фундаментальная структура включает слой получения данных, который принимает события из наружных источников и конвертирует их в стандартизированный вид. Следующий ярус производит бизнес-логику: определяет параметры, находит отклонения, задействует правила обработки. Итоги поступают в ярус экспорта для записи или отправки.

Актуальные решения поддерживают два варианта к обработке. Первый обслуживает каждое инцидент индивидуально моментально после принятия. Второй объединяет происшествия в минипакеты и преобразует их с промежутком в несколько секунд. Выбор зависит от запросов к отсрочке и количеству данных.

Части построения сотрудничают через единообразные каналы, что позволяет заменять конкретные компоненты без перестройки целой платформы. 1хбет казино предоставляет адаптивность при корректировке требований.

Очереди и шины данных: как инциденты передаются между службами

Передача событий между частями платформы выполняется через выделенные средства транспортировки уведомлениями. Очереди данных предоставляют стабильную передачу данных от источников к получателям с гарантией безопасности при авариях.

Каналы данных составляют собой распределенные платформы для размещения и подписки на потоки событий. Источники посылают сообщения в именованные каналы, а потребители регистрируются на необходимые направления. Такая схема дает единственному происшествию доходить набора получателей параллельно.

Фундаментальные особенности механизмов передачи происшествий включают:

  • Пропускную производительность — объем сообщений в период времени
  • Латентность доставки — время между отправкой и принятием
  • Обеспечения передачи — уровень устойчивости передачи
  • Последовательность — удержание последовательности инцидентов

Механизмы кэширования аккумулируют события при преходящей недоступности адресатов. 1xbet казино сохраняет сообщения на диске до времени завершенной обработки. Копирование между компонентами исключает потерю информации при отказе машин.

Подходы обработки

Системы реального времени задействуют разные модели обработки инцидентов в обусловленности от бизнес-требований и специфики данных. Каждая вариант описывает способ группировки, изучения и конвертации приходящих последовательностей.

Обработка отдельных событий исследует каждое сообщение автономно от других. Платформа задействует принципы отбора и дополнения к каждой записи сразу после получения. Такой метод снижает задержки и применим для важных случаев с условием немедленной отклика.

Временная преобразование группирует происшествия по хронологическим промежуткам или числу элементов. Механизм собирает информацию в продолжение определённого отрезка, далее выполняет суммирование и определение показателей. Интервалы могут быть статичными, динамичными или сеансовыми в связи от алгоритма программы.

Преобразование с сохранением положения удерживает окружение между происшествиями. Платформа сохраняет переходные результаты, индикаторы, сохраненные данные для последующих операций. 1иксбет эксплуатирует распределенное хранилище для гарантирования целостности. Модель без положения обрабатывает события независимо, что улучшает расширение.

Хранение данных: оперативные (real-time) и холодные (архивные) слои

Структура хранения данных в платформах реального времени делится на несколько слоев в обусловленности от частоты запроса и запросов к скорости получения. Такое разделение снижает затраты и предоставляет компромисс между производительностью и ценой.

Горячий слой хранит современные данные, к которым нужен немедленный обращение. Информация помещается в оперативной ОЗУ или на быстрых SSD-дисках для уменьшения времени отклика. Хранилища этого слоя обслуживают тысячи обращений в секунду. Срок размещения достигает от нескольких часов до нескольких дней.

Тёплый слой удерживает данные промежуточного периода для исследования и формирования отчетов. Инциденты мигрируют сюда автоматически после исхода срока релевантности. 1хбет казино обеспечивает компромисс между темпом запроса и размером размещения.

Холодный архивный уровень используется для долгосрочного сохранения старых сведений. Информация хранится на экономичных носителях с замедленным доступом. Репозитории используются для удовлетворения условиям надзорных органов, аудита и исследования паттернов. Период размещения может доходить нескольких лет.

Увеличение и отказоустойчивость

Способность системы обслуживать увеличивающиеся объёмы данных и сохранять дееспособность при неполадках задает её устойчивость в боевой обстановке. Архитектура должна предусматривать инструменты горизонтального расширения и резервирования ключевых элементов.

Горизонтальное масштабирование подключает дополнительные компоненты обработки при увеличении трафика. События автоматически распределяются между готовыми серверами в соответствии алгоритмам распределения. Механизм активно адаптируется к изменению последовательности данных без прерывания.

Инструменты гарантирования надежности 1xbet казино включают:

  • Дублирование данных между компонентами для предотвращения исчезновений
  • Автоматическое переход на резервные части при неполадке
  • Фиксирующие метки для фиксации положения обработки
  • Реставрация с возобновлением с крайнего зафиксированного статуса

Распределение трафика производится на фундаменте признаков партиционирования, которые устанавливают распределение инцидентов к процессорам. 1иксбет обеспечивает последовательную преобразование взаимосвязанных происшествий на одном узле. Контроль состояния узлов позволяет выявлять ухудшение скорости и переназначать функции.

Наблюдение и алертинг: как наблюдают статус последовательностей и откликаются на аномалии

Непрестанное отслеживание за состоянием механизма обработки событий обеспечивает выявлять проблемы до их существенного влияния на бизнес-процессы. Средства контроля получают показатели производительности и производят уведомления при вариациях от стандартных параметров.

Главные показатели охватывают скорость получения инцидентов, задержку обработки, длину очередей и долю ошибок. Системы наблюдают нагрузку процессоров, использование памяти и дискового места на серверах кластера. Диаграммы отображают движение метрик в реальном времени.

Пороговые значения определяют границы стандартного работы для каждой параметра. При превышении ограничений платформа автоматом генерирует предупреждения для операторов. 1хбет казино обеспечивает конфигурировать принципы алертинга с учетом серьезности разнообразных категорий происшествий.

Анализ аномалий использует математические методы для обнаружения нестандартных моделей в массивах данных. Процедуры обнаруживают стремительные броски трафика, нетипичные череды происшествий, сомнительную поведение. Самостоятельные отклики содержат увеличение мощностей, перенаправление на альтернативные каналы или снижение поступающего нагрузки.

Иллюстрации использования комплексов обработки происшествий

Экономические организации применяют платформы обработки происшествий для обнаружения фальшивых операций. Методы рассматривают каждую действие по карте в момент проведения, соотнося с прошлыми моделями действий заказчика. При определении странной поведения система останавливает перевод за миллисекунды.

Интернет-магазины эксплуатируют потоковую преобразование для настройки рекомендаций товаров. Происшествия посещения страниц, включения в список и покупок преобразуются в реальном времени. Система производит современные рекомендации на фундаменте текущего активности клиента.

Производственные заводы применяют мониторинг устройств для прогнозного поддержки. Измерители на производственных линиях отправляют данные вибрации, температуры и энергопотребления. 1иксбет рассматривает сведения и предсказывает возможные поломки, что дает организовывать обслуживание без непредвиденных остановок.

Перевозочные организации контролируют движение товаров и улучшают маршруты доставки. GPS-трекеры производят координаты перевозочных автомобилей каждые несколько секунд. Система рассматривает заторы и срочность доставок для адаптивной настройки путей и информирования получателей о времени прибытия.